Awarded to Atul Sharma in 2011 under the Supervision of Dr. Dimple Juneja and Dr. A.K Sharma
This thesis has presented a complete framework for deploying WSN in subsurfaces with a view to increase in production and real-time monitoring of oil fields. Setting the sensor network within a harsh environment like oil wells is not only unique with respect to ongoing developments in subsurface explorations, but it also brings a range of features from the sensor world that can aid development and ease the monitoring of subsurfaces. In fact, by incorporating mobile sensors beneath the earth crust, the work attempts to introduce intelligence & decision-making capability not only in the technology applied for the exploration but also to the base station where all observations are recorded. Incorporating WSN and intelligence into subsurfaces shall make them self-organizing, self-managing intelligent field. The intelligence is taken out of the sensors in the form of information and can be further assessed by scientific community for real-time visualization.
